Output 924393d546c95740269babdcb96de36894eaed3a8438adbd04055759b6f59d19:1

value
17260552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efac1dc11e96541089968659b4946ad8175435c OP_EQUAL
address
3DGRTdktCpzB5KwVZFFDBhqt9YaP2a6ncK
transaction
924393d546c95740269babdcb96de36894eaed3a8438adbd04055759b6f59d19
spent
true